Anthropic offers self-hosted Claude agents and private network access

Anthropic has launched new features for its Claude Managed Agents, including self-hosted sandboxes in public beta and MCP tunnels in research preview. Self-hosted sandboxes allow companies to run agent tool execution within their own infrastructure, enhancing data privacy and control. MCP tunnels enable Claude agents to securely access private network resources without exposing them publicly, addressing critical security concerns for businesses. AI
